¿Qué es Base de datos columnar?
Una base de datos columnar es un tipo de base de datos en el que los datos se organizan y almacenan en columnas en lugar de filas. En una base de datos relacional tradicional, los datos se almacenan en filas y cada fila representa una instancia de una entidad. En cambio, en una base de datos columnar, cada columna representa una variable o atributo y todas las filas tienen los mismos atributos.
Este tipo de organización de datos es particularmente adecuado para aplicaciones de análisis y procesamiento de datos, incluyendo inteligencia artificial y machine learning, ya que permite una recuperación de datos más rápida y eficiente para operaciones de agregación y filtrado de datos.
Las bases de datos columnares se utilizan a menudo en aplicaciones de big data y en entornos de procesamiento distribuido, ya que permiten un alto rendimiento en consultas de agregación y análisis de grandes conjuntos de datos. Algunas de las bases de datos columnares más conocidas incluyen Apache Cassandra, Apache HBase y Apache Druid.